Curaçao’s heritage comes through in layers on this walking tour: Dutch-influenced architecture, Jewish history, African traditions, and the island’s broader Caribbean identity all show up in the same compact landscape. The result is a tour that feels lived-in rather than textbook. You’re not just looking at buildings and landmarks; you’re getting context for how Curaçao became the multicultural place it is today. That makes the experience especially rewarding if you like history that connects architecture, migration, and daily life. With a 2.5-hour duration and no transport included, this is easy to fit into a port call if you’re staying near the start point or comfortable arranging your own way there. The moderate walking, high heat, and moderate crowd scores point to a tour that’s best handled with good shoes, shade-minded clothing, and water. The very high culture score and high value rating are the main reasons to choose it. This is best for you if you enjoy learning while you walk, want a meaningful overview of Curaçao’s identity, or prefer a calm shore excursion that doesn’t require special fitness.
